Skip to main content

Janela: Personalização de Processo

[Criado em: 24/11/2017 - Atualizado em: 24/09/2019 ]
Descrição: Personalização de Processo
Ajuda: Personalização de Processo

Aba: Personalização de Processo

[Criado em: 24/11/2017 - Atualizado em: 16/10/2020 ]
Descrição: Personalização de Processo
Ajuda: Personalização de Processo
Nível da Aba: 0

Tabela 10: Personalização de Processo - Campos

NomeDescriçãoAjudaDados Técnicos
EmpresaEmpresa/Locatário para esta instalação.Uma Empresa é uma Companhia ou uma Entidade Legal (pessoa jurídica). Dados não podem ser compartilhados entre Empresas. Locatário é um sinônimo para Empresa (Client).

ad_userdef_proc.AD_Client_ID

numeric(10)
Table Direct
OrganizaçãoEntidade organizacional dentro da EmpresaUma "Organização" é uma unidade de sua "Empresa" ou "Entidade Legal" - os exemplos são loja, departamento. Você pode compartilhar dados entre organizações.

ad_userdef_proc.AD_Org_ID

numeric(10)
Table Direct
PerfilPerfil de AcessoO "Perfil" determina o nível de segurança e acesso que um usuário que exerça este Perfil terá no Sistema.

ad_userdef_proc.AD_Role_ID

numeric(10)
Table Direct
Usuário/ContatoUsuário dentro do Sistema - Interno ou Contato de Parceiro de NegóciosO Usuário identifica um usuário único e exclusivo dentro do sistema. Este poderia ser um usuário interno ou um contato de parceiro de negócios

ad_userdef_proc.AD_User_ID

numeric(10)
Search
ProcessoProcesso ou RelatórioO campo "Processo" identifica um único Processo ou Relatório no sistema.

ad_userdef_proc.AD_Process_ID

numeric(10)
Search
AtivoO registro está ativo no sistemaExistem dois métodos de tornar um registro indisponível no sistema: O primeiro é excluir o registro, o outro é desativar o registro. Um registro desativado não está disponível para seleção, mas está disponível para relatórios. Existem duas razões para desativar um registro ao invés de excluí-lo: (1) O sistema exige o registro para fins de auditoria. (2) O registro é referenciado por outros registros. Ex. você não pode excluir um Parceiro de Negócios, se existirem faturas para este parceiro de negócios. Você desativa o Parceiro de Negócios e previne que este registro seja usado para entradas futuras.

ad_userdef_proc.IsActive

character(1)
Yes-No
NomeIdentificador Alfanumérico da entidadeO nome de uma entidade (registro) é usado como uma opção de pesquisa padrão em adição à chave de pesquisa. O nome pode ter até 60 caracteres de comprimento.

ad_userdef_proc.Name

character varying(60)
String
DescriçãoDescrição resumida opcional do registroUma descrição é limitada a 255 caracteres.

ad_userdef_proc.Description

character varying(255)
String
Comentário/AjudaComentário ou DicaO campo "Ajuda" contém uma dica, comentário ou ajuda sobre o uso deste item.

ad_userdef_proc.Help

character varying(2000)
Text
IdiomaIdioma para esta entidadeO "Idioma" identifica a língua a ser utilizada para exibição e formatação

ad_userdef_proc.AD_Language

character varying(6)
Table

Aba: Personalização de Parâmetro

[Criado em: 24/11/2017 - Atualizado em: 16/10/2020 ]
Descrição: Personalização de Parâmetro
Ajuda: Personalização de Parâmetro
Nível da Aba: 1

Tabela 20: Personalização de Parâmetro - Campos

NomeDescriçãoAjudaDados Técnicos
EmpresaEmpresa/Locatário para esta instalação.Uma Empresa é uma Companhia ou uma Entidade Legal (pessoa jurídica). Dados não podem ser compartilhados entre Empresas. Locatário é um sinônimo para Empresa (Client).

ad_userdef_proc_parameter.AD_Client_ID

numeric(10)
Table Direct
OrganizaçãoEntidade organizacional dentro da EmpresaUma "Organização" é uma unidade de sua "Empresa" ou "Entidade Legal" - os exemplos são loja, departamento. Você pode compartilhar dados entre organizações.

ad_userdef_proc_parameter.AD_Org_ID

numeric(10)
Table Direct
Janela definida pelo UsuárioJanela definida pelo UsuárioJanela definida pelo Usuário

ad_userdef_proc_parameter.AD_UserDef_Proc_ID

numeric(10)
Table Direct
AtivoO registro está ativo no sistemaExistem dois métodos de tornar um registro indisponível no sistema: O primeiro é excluir o registro, o outro é desativar o registro. Um registro desativado não está disponível para seleção, mas está disponível para relatórios. Existem duas razões para desativar um registro ao invés de excluí-lo: (1) O sistema exige o registro para fins de auditoria. (2) O registro é referenciado por outros registros. Ex. você não pode excluir um Parceiro de Negócios, se existirem faturas para este parceiro de negócios. Você desativa o Parceiro de Negócios e previne que este registro seja usado para entradas futuras.

ad_userdef_proc_parameter.IsActive

character(1)
Yes-No
Parâmetro de Processo

ad_userdef_proc_parameter.AD_Process_Para_ID

numeric(10)
Table Direct
FaixaO parâmetro é uma faixa de valoresA caixa de verificação "Faixa" indica que este parâmetro é uma faixa de valores.

ad_userdef_proc_parameter.IsRange

character(1)
Yes-No
NomeIdentificador Alfanumérico da entidadeO nome de uma entidade (registro) é usado como uma opção de pesquisa padrão em adição à chave de pesquisa. O nome pode ter até 60 caracteres de comprimento.

ad_userdef_proc_parameter.Name

character varying(60)
String
DescriçãoDescrição resumida opcional do registroUma descrição é limitada a 255 caracteres.

ad_userdef_proc_parameter.Description

character varying(255)
String
Comentário/AjudaComentário ou DicaO campo "Ajuda" contém uma dica, comentário ou ajuda sobre o uso deste item.

ad_userdef_proc_parameter.Help

character varying(2000)
Text
Placeholder

ad_userdef_proc_parameter.Placeholder

character varying(255)
String
Placeholder2

ad_userdef_proc_parameter.Placeholder2

character varying(255)
String
SeqüênciaMétodo de ordenação de registros; o menor número vem primeiroA "Seqüência" indica a ordem dos registros

ad_userdef_proc_parameter.SeqNo

numeric(10)
Integer
ReferênciaReferência do Sistema e ValidaçãoA Referência poderia ser um tipo de exibição, lista tabela de validação.

ad_userdef_proc_parameter.AD_Reference_ID

numeric(10)
Table
Chave de ReferênciaÉ preciso especificar, se o tipo de dados for Tabela ou ListaO "Valor de Referência" indica onde os valores de referência são armazenados. Tem que ser especificado se o tipo de dados é Tabela ou Lista.

ad_userdef_proc_parameter.AD_Reference_Value_ID

numeric(10)
Table
Formato do ValorFormato do Valor; Pode conter elementos de formato fixo, Variáveis: "_lLoOaAcCa09"Elementos de Validação: (Espaço) qualquer caracter _Espaço (caracter fixo) lqualquer Letra a..Z SEM espaço Lqualquer Letra a..Z SEM espaço convertido em maiúsculo oqualquer Letra a..Z ou espaço Oqualquer Letra a..Z ou espaço convertido em maiúsculo aquaisquer Letras & Dígitos SEM espaço Aquaisquer Letras & Dígitos SEM espaço convertido em maiúsculo cquaisquer Letras & Dígitos ou espaço Cquaisquer Letras & Dígitos ou espaço convertido em maiúsculo 0Dígitos 0..9 SEM espaço 9Dígitos 0..9 ou espaçoExemplo de formato "(000)_000-0000"

ad_userdef_proc_parameter.VFormat

character varying(40)
String
Validação DinâmicaRegra de Validação DinâmicaEstas regras definem como um registro é determinado como válido ou inválido. Você pode usar variáveis para validação dinâmica (sensível ao contexto).

ad_userdef_proc_parameter.AD_Val_Rule_ID

numeric(10)
Table Direct
Lógica PadrãoHierarquia de Valor padrão, separada por ;Os padrões são calculados na ordem de definição, o primeiro valor não nulo se torna o valor padrão da coluna. Os valores são separados por vírgula ou ponto e vírgula. a) Literais:. 'Texto' ou 123 b) Variáveis - no formato @Variável@ - Login ex. #Date, #AD_Org_ID, #AD_Client_ID - Esquema Contábil: ex. , - Padrões Globais: ex. DateFormat - Valores de Janela (Todas as Seleções, Caixas de Verificação, Botões tipo Rádio, e DateDoc/DateAcct) c) Código SQL com o tag: @SQL=SELECT algumaCoisa AS ValorPadrão FROM ... A declaração SQL pode conter variáveis. Não pode haver outro valor que não seja a declaração SQL. O padrão só é calculado se não for definida nenhuma preferência do usuário. Definições padrão, assim como Botões, são ignoradas para colunas de registro tais como Chave, Pai, Empresa.

ad_userdef_proc_parameter.DefaultValue

character varying(2000)
String
Lógica Padrão 2Hierarquia de Valor padrão, separada por ;Os padrões são calculados na ordem de definição, o primeiro valor não nulo se torna o valor padrão da coluna. Os valores são separados por vírgula ou ponto e vírgula. a) Literais:. 'Texto' ou 123 b) Variáveis - no formato @Variável@ - Login ex. #Date, #AD_Org_ID, #AD_Client_ID - Esquema Contábil: ex. , - Padrões Globais: ex. DateFormat - Valores de Janela (Todas as Seleções, Caixas de Verificação, Botões tipo Rádio, e DateDoc/DateAcct) c) Código SQL com o tag: @SQL=SELECT algumaCoisa AS ValorPadrão FROM ... A declaração SQL pode conter variáveis. Não pode haver outro valor que não seja a declaração SQL. O padrão só é calculado se não for definida nenhuma preferência do usuário. Definições padrão, assim como Botões, são ignoradas para colunas de registro tais como Chave, Pai, Empresa.

ad_userdef_proc_parameter.DefaultValue2

character varying(2000)
String
Mín. ValorMínimo Valor para um campoO "Mínimo Valor" indica o menor valor permissível para um campo.

ad_userdef_proc_parameter.ValueMin

character varying(20)
String
Máx. ValorMáximo Valor para um campoO "Máximo Valor" indica o maior valor permissível para um campo

ad_userdef_proc_parameter.ValueMax

character varying(20)
String
ObrigatórioÉ exigida a entrada de dados nesta colunaO campo tem que ter um valor para que o registro seja salvo no banco de dados.

ad_userdef_proc_parameter.IsMandatory

character(1)
List
MostradoDetermina se um campo é mostradoSe o campo for mostrado, o campo "Lógica de Visualização" irá determinar em tempo de execução, se ele será realmente mostrado

ad_userdef_proc_parameter.IsDisplayed

character(1)
List
Lógica Somente de LeituraLógica para determinar se o campo é somente de leitura (read only) .Aplicável somente quando os campos forem de leitura-escrita (read-write)format := {expression} [{logic} {expression}] expression := @{context}@{operand}{value} or @{context}@{operand}{value} logic := {|}|{&} context := qualquer contexto global ou de janela value := textos ou números operadores lógicos:= AND ou OR com o resultado anterior da esquerda para a direita operand := eq{=}, gt{>}, le{<}, not{~^!} Exemplos: @AD_Table_ID@=14 | @Language@!GERGER @PriceLimit@>10 | @PriceList@>@PriceActual@ @Name@>J Textos podem estar entre aspas simples (opcional)

ad_userdef_proc_parameter.ReadOnlyLogic

character varying(2000)
Text
Lógica de VisualizaçãoSe o campo for mostrado, o resultado determina se o campo será realmente mostradoformat := {expression} [{logic} {expression}] expression := @{context}@{operand}{value} or @{context}@{operand}{value} logic := {|}|{&} context := qualquer contexto global ou de janela value := textos ou números operadores lógicos:= AND ou OR com o resultado anterior da esquerda para a direita operand := eq{=}, gt{>}, le{<}, not{~^!} Exemplos: @AD_Table_ID@=14 | @Language@!GERGER @PriceLimit@>10 | @PriceList@>@PriceActual@ @Name@>J Textos podem estar entre aspas simples (opcional)

ad_userdef_proc_parameter.DisplayLogic

character varying(2000)
Text
Lógica de ObrigatórioIndica a Lógica de Obrigatoriedade de um CampoEx. @Campo@='Y'

ad_userdef_proc_parameter.MandatoryLogic

character varying(2000)
Text
Grupo de CampoAgrupamento de campos lógicosO "Grupo de Campo" indica o grupo lógico a que este campo pertence (Histórico, Valores, Quantidades)

ad_userdef_proc_parameter.AD_FieldGroup_ID

numeric(10)
Table Direct